Same resolution, different size: it is all about pixel density
4K is a fixed number of pixels — 3840 across, 2160 down. When you pack those pixels into a smaller 27" panel, they sit closer together, giving a very high pixel density. Spread the same pixels across a larger 32" panel and the density drops to something more moderate. Nothing else about the comparison makes sense until you understand this one trade-off:
- 27" 4K — very high density. Exceptionally sharp, with no visible pixels at a normal viewing distance. The catch: everything the operating system draws is small.
- 32" 4K — moderate-to-high density. Still clearly sharp, but the larger panel makes text and interface elements more comfortably readable without any adjustment.
The scaling question — the part people miss
This is where the two sizes really split. Because a 27" 4K panel is so dense, the operating system's menus, text and icons render tiny at their native size. To fix that, you run OS scaling — typically around 150% — which keeps everything sharp while making it a readable size. For most people this works beautifully, but a handful of older creative applications still scale imperfectly, leaving slightly fuzzy menus or oddly sized panels.
A 32" 4K panel sidesteps much of this. Its lower density means the interface is already a comfortable size, so you can often run near native (100%) or apply only light scaling — and in return you get more usable physical workspace at native resolution.
- 27" 4K: almost always needs scaling (~150%); excellent results, with occasional quirks in older creative software.
- 32" 4K: often comfortable at or near 100%; more real workspace for timelines, panels and toolbars without aggressive scaling.
Viewing distance and desk depth
Size is not just about pixels — it is about how the screen physically fits your space. A 32" panel is large enough that it wants to sit a little further back, and you will move your eyes and head more to take in the corners. A 27" panel suits a closer, more compact seating position. Before you choose, measure your desk:
- Shallow desk or close seating: a 27" panel is the safer, more comfortable fit.
- Deeper desk with room to lean back: a 32" panel rewards you with more workspace without feeling overwhelming.
- Either way: measure your desk depth first — a 32" screen too close to your face is tiring, not impressive.
Who the 27" 4K suits
The 27" is the sharpness-and-space-saver choice. It is the right pick when:
- Your desk is shallow or your room is tight, and you sit relatively close.
- You want the maximum possible sharpness and crispest text on screen.
- You are happy to run OS scaling and your software is reasonably modern.
- You want a slightly lower price and a smaller GPU load to drive it.
Who the 32" 4K suits
The 32" is the workspace choice — it earns its place for creators who want more room to work. Consider it when:

- You want a comfortable, readable interface without aggressive scaling.
- You have the desk depth to sit a little further back.

Frequently Asked Questions
Is a 27" 4K monitor too small to be worth it over 1440p? Not at all — the extra sharpness is genuinely visible, especially for text and fine detail. The only real cost is that you almost always run OS scaling, which is usually seamless on modern software.
Will I have to use scaling on a 32" 4K too? Often no, or only lightly. The larger panel spreads the pixels enough that the interface is comfortable near 100%, which is exactly why many creators prefer it for the extra native workspace.
Does a 32" need a more powerful GPU than a 27"? No — they are the same 4K resolution, so the graphics demand is identical. Size affects your desk and your eyes, not your GPU load.
